I'm sorry to hear the story turned out to be false.  However, I do have a true story:

When the Arizona Congresswoman was shot last year, the WBC announced that they would be traveling to Arizona to protest at the funeral of the 8-year-old girl that was one of the victims--she was Catholic, although what that had to do with anything I don't know.

My sister lives there, and signed up to be one of the thousands of people who were going to surround the whole area with a human shield.  Someone from Arizona contacted the WBC to let them know: 1) We're ready for you. 2) This is a concealed-carry state.  At the last minute, they heard that the WBC had changed their mind.  My sister said a lot of people there were very disappointed--they were ready to do some damage to the "church."
